McGregor and Mayweather have finally made it official that the two will be taking to the ring for a junior middleweight boxing match in Las Vegas on 26 August.
McGregor still throws hands in the UFC and the 40-year-old Mayweather officially retired in 2015, but it's expected both fighters could pick up licenses in no time at all.
McGregor spent most of his mixed martial arts career competing at 145lbs but has most recently fought at 155lbs, the weight at which he claimed the UFC lightweight title last November.
According to MMA Fighting, the fight will be sanctioned by the Nevada Athletic Commision and be listed as a professional boxing match.
The fight - under boxing rules - is bound to draw huge interest from fans and massive pay days for the two fighters.

Given McGregor's non-existent boxing experience and Mayweather's reputation as one of the finest fighters in history, many observers are already predicting a mismatch.
"We've been in negotiations for a while", White told SportsCenter. Rovell estimates Mayweather-McGregor will take in $60.5 million in ticket sales, nearly $20 million less than the $79.1 million that Mayweather's fight with Pacquiao claimed. The pair will battle at 154-pounds, in 10-oz. gloves, for a maximum of 12 rounds.
